Searched refs:Binding (Results 1 - 25 of 176) sorted by relevance

12345678

/external/guice/core/src/com/google/inject/spi/
H A DUntargettedBinding.java19 import com.google.inject.Binding;
28 public interface UntargettedBinding<T> extends Binding<T> {}
H A DLinkedKeyBinding.java19 import com.google.inject.Binding;
28 public interface LinkedKeyBinding<T> extends Binding<T> {
H A DConvertedConstantBinding.java19 import com.google.inject.Binding;
31 public interface ConvertedConstantBinding<T> extends Binding<T>, HasDependencies {
H A DExposedBinding.java20 import com.google.inject.Binding;
28 public interface ExposedBinding<T> extends Binding<T>, HasDependencies {
H A DInstanceBinding.java19 import com.google.inject.Binding;
29 public interface InstanceBinding<T> extends Binding<T>, HasDependencies {
H A DProviderBinding.java19 import com.google.inject.Binding;
30 public interface ProviderBinding<T extends Provider<?>> extends Binding<T> {
H A DProviderInstanceBinding.java19 import com.google.inject.Binding;
31 public interface ProviderInstanceBinding<T> extends Binding<T>, HasDependencies {
H A DProviderKeyBinding.java19 import com.google.inject.Binding;
29 public interface ProviderKeyBinding<T> extends Binding<T> {
H A DConstructorBinding.java19 import com.google.inject.Binding;
33 public interface ConstructorBinding<T> extends Binding<T>, HasDependencies {
H A DProvisionListener.java19 import com.google.inject.Binding;
60 * Returns the Binding this is provisioning.
63 * {@link Binding#getProvider}, otherwise you will get confusing error messages.
65 public abstract Binding<T> getBinding();
H A DDefaultBindingTargetVisitor.java19 import com.google.inject.Binding;
23 * #visitOther(Binding)}, returning its result.
36 protected V visitOther(Binding<? extends T> binding) {
74 // TODO(cushon): remove raw (Binding) cast when we don't care about javac 6 anymore
75 return visitOther((Binding<? extends T>) (Binding) providerBinding);
H A DProviderWithExtensionVisitor.java19 import com.google.inject.Binding;
28 * {@link Binding#acceptTargetVisitor(BindingTargetVisitor)} method to visit a
H A DProvisionListenerBinding.java21 import com.google.inject.Binding;
36 private final Matcher<? super Binding<?>> bindingMatcher;
40 Matcher<? super Binding<?>> bindingMatcher,
55 public Matcher<? super Binding<?>> getBindingMatcher() {
/external/guice/extensions/grapher/src/com/google/inject/grapher/
H A DAliasCreator.java19 import com.google.inject.Binding;
37 Iterable<Alias> createAliases(Iterable<Binding<?>> bindings);
H A DEdgeCreator.java19 import com.google.inject.Binding;
31 Iterable<Edge> getEdges(Iterable<Binding<?>> bindings);
H A DNodeCreator.java19 import com.google.inject.Binding;
30 Iterable<Node> getNodes(Iterable<Binding<?>> bindings);
H A DProviderAliasCreator.java20 import com.google.inject.Binding;
25 * Alias creator that creates an alias for each {@link ProviderBinding}. These {@link Binding}s
33 @Override public Iterable<Alias> createAliases(Iterable<Binding<?>> bindings) {
35 for (Binding<?> binding : bindings) {
/external/guice/extensions/jmx/src/com/google/inject/tools/jmx/
H A DManagedBinding.java19 import com.google.inject.Binding;
23 final Binding binding;
25 ManagedBinding(Binding binding) {
/external/guice/extensions/multibindings/src/com/google/inject/multibindings/
H A DOptionalBinderBinding.java19 import com.google.inject.Binding;
29 * OptionalBinderBinding exists only on the Binding associated with the
49 * The Binding's type will always match the type Optional's generic type. For example, if getKey
51 * <code>Binding&lt;String></code>.
53 Binding<?> getDefaultBinding();
60 * The Binding's type will always match the type Optional's generic type. For example, if getKey
62 * <code>Binding&lt;String></code>.
64 Binding<?> getActualBinding();
H A DMapBinderBinding.java19 import com.google.inject.Binding;
34 * MapBinderBinding exists only on the Binding associated with the Map&lt;K, V> key. Other
76 * <code>List&lt;Map.Entry&lt;String, Binding&lt;Snack>>></code>.
78 List<Map.Entry<?, Binding<?>>> getEntries();
H A DMultibinderBinding.java19 import com.google.inject.Binding;
57 * <code>List&lt;Binding&lt;String>></code>.
59 List<Binding<?>> getElements();
/external/guice/core/test/com/google/inject/spi/
H A DFailingTargetVisitor.java19 import com.google.inject.Binding;
24 @Override protected Void visitOther(Binding<? extends T> binding) {
H A DBindingTargetVisitorTest.java18 import com.google.inject.Binding;
33 for (Binding<?> binding : injector.getBindings().values()) {
/external/guice/core/src/com/google/inject/
H A DInjector.java106 Map<Key<?>, Binding<?>> getBindings();
121 Map<Key<?>, Binding<?>> getAllBindings();
132 <T> Binding<T> getBinding(Key<T> key);
144 <T> Binding<T> getBinding(Class<T> type);
155 <T> Binding<T> getExistingBinding(Key<T> key);
162 <T> List<Binding<T>> findBindingsByType(TypeLiteral<T> type);
/external/swiftshader/third_party/LLVM/lib/MC/
H A DMCELF.cpp22 void MCELF::SetBinding(MCSymbolData &SD, unsigned Binding) { argument
23 assert(Binding == ELF::STB_LOCAL || Binding == ELF::STB_GLOBAL ||
24 Binding == ELF::STB_WEAK);
26 SD.setFlags(OtherFlags | (Binding << ELF_STB_Shift));
30 uint32_t Binding = (SD.getFlags() & (0xf << ELF_STB_Shift)) >> ELF_STB_Shift; local
31 assert(Binding == ELF::STB_LOCAL || Binding == ELF::STB_GLOBAL ||
32 Binding == ELF::STB_WEAK);
33 return Binding;
[all...]

Completed in 230 milliseconds

12345678